Google Gemini 3 Racks Up 100 Million New Active Users, Challenging ChatGPT’s Dominance

The artificial intelligence landscape is witnessing a seismic shift, confirmed by new data showing the meteoric rise of Google’s flagship model. The release of Gemini 3 has propelled Google into a serious contention for the AI crown, successfully winning over more than 100 million new active users in a stunning display of market adoption.

This massive influx of users signifies more than just successful marketing; it suggests that Gemini is rapidly establishing itself as the preferred alternative, or even replacement, for existing generative AI tools. For years, OpenAI’s ChatGPT has set the benchmark, but Google, utilizing its immense technological infrastructure and existing product ecosystem, is aggressively closing the gap.

The Significance of the 100 Million Milestone

Reaching 100 million new active users in a short timeframe is a monumental achievement, especially in a saturated tech market. This number indicates powerful organic growth and effective feature rollout. Google has been integrating Gemini’s capabilities across its popular suite of tools—from Search and Workspace to the Android operating system. This native integration offers a seamless experience that competitors struggle to match, giving Gemini an immediate, low-friction path to massive adoption.

While the initial iterations of Gemini showed promise, the third major release seems to have hit a stride in terms of performance, multimodality, and reliability. Users are increasingly leveraging AI for complex tasks, and the perception of Gemini as a highly capable and trustworthy tool, backed by Google’s reputation, is clearly driving these usage statistics.

The AI Battle Heats Up

The competition between Google and OpenAI is not just a technological race but a fundamental battle for the future of digital interaction. As the report indicates, “Gemini is coming for ChatGPT’s crown.” This rapid user acquisition challenges the foundational lead that ChatGPT established and forces OpenAI to innovate even faster to retain its existing user base and appeal to new demographics. The pressure is on both companies to continually advance their models, not just in raw computational power, but in real-world applicability.

For consumers, this fierce competition is excellent news. It drives better, more powerful, and more affordable AI services. Google’s commitment to making Gemini a central component of its user experience means that AI functionality is becoming democratized and integrated into everyday digital life.
